José Rizal - Filipino nationalist and novelist

 


Jose Rizal, a Filipino Nationalist and Novelist, was born on June 19 in Calamba City, Laguna Municipality, in the Philippines. Rizal is remembered as a great hero and the voice of the Filipino people during the Spaniards' colonization in the late 19th century. Through his writings, he fought for peaceful reforms while exposing the ills that beset the country.


A prolific writer, he wrote his novels "Noli Me Tangere" and "El Filibusterismo" to expose the ills of Philippine society; government corruption, abuse; and on a larger scale, the effects of colonization on people's lives.

Rizal was arrested and convicted on charges of rebellion, sedition, and conspiracy which led to his execution on December 30, 1896. Now revered as a national hero Rizal's novels are standard texts in Filipino schools.
